15/03/2024 (Agence Europe) – On Friday, 15 March, members of the G7 stressed that they are extremely concerned about news that Iran is reportedly considering transferring ballistic missiles and related technology to Russia. Calling on Tehran to not proceed with this course of action, they warned in a joint statement, “Were Iran to proceed with providing ballistic missiles or related technology to Russia, we are prepared to respond swiftly and in a coordinated manner including with new and significant measures against Iran.” In their opinion, doing so would contribute to regional destabilisation and would represent a substantive material escalation in its support for the war in Ukraine. The G7 has reiterated its call on third parties to immediately cease providing material support to Russia’s illegal and unjustifiable war of aggression against Ukraine “or face severe costs”. (CG)
